Firm Overview

At Collins & Hepler, PLC, we approach each case with care and integrity. We are privileged to have enjoyed a long history of service to the Alleghany Highlands and surrounding areas, and we are proud of our record of success. We strive to provide personalized, principled, and aggressive representation, whether defending a simple traffic citation, or pursuing a complex appeal to the Supreme Court of Virginia.

The Collins family has been providing legal services in the Highlands for nearly 100 years. Michael M. Collins, a native of Covington, Virginia, was preceded in the Covington office by his father, Hale Collins (1901-1971), who served twenty years in the Virginia Legislature.

We are proud to be the first law firm in Alleghany and surrounding counties to offer Medicaid estate planning services, as well as assistance and guidance through the Medicaid process, to help you and your loved ones to preserve and maintain the maximum allowable assets and income when faced with nursing home debt.

We are proud to be the only firm to offer a unique farm and land protection strategy involving a combination of specialized trusts and conservation easements, to preserve and protect the sanctity of your land throughout future generations.

Our attorneys have handled hundreds of personal injury claims over the course of decades, and have achieved substantial verdicts and settlements in automobile accident, medical malpractice, nursing home negligence, and other cases.

We also bring decades of experience to our criminal defense practice, ranging from traffic infractions and DUI's to serious felonies.

Although firmly anchored in tradition, we embrace technological change and innovation, and we employ and enjoy the advantages of digital advances both in the office and in the courtroom.

At Collins & Hepler, PLC we are a small firm with big abilities. We provide general legal services to the counties of Alleghany, Rockbridge, Botetourt, and Bath, but we will gladly assist with land and farm protection anywhere in the state of Virginia.

Michael McHale Collins, Esq.

Michael McHale Collins, Esq. - Mr. Collins earned his Bachelor of Arts degree from the University of Virginia in Charlottesville in 1966. He received his law degree in 1970 from The College of William & Mary, where he was the managing editor of the William & Mary Law Review and a member of the Omicron Delta Kappa Honorary Fraternity. He is a former president of the Covington-Hot Springs Rotary club and the William & Mary Law School Alumni Association, and was an active member of the Advisory Board of the Alleghany Highlands Community Housing Improvement Program. He has served as director for numerous other organizations including the Dabney S. Lancaster Community College Board of Trustees, the State Bank of the Alleghenies, the Alleghany Highlands Free Clinic and the Garth Newel Music Center.
